Keloid scars cannot be completely removed to restore skin to its original state. Modern treatments significantly improve appearance and flatten the tissue. While surgical excision is possible, doctors must combine it with radiation or injections. This prevents the scar from growing back larger due to new trauma.

Patient Consensus: Patients note that steroid injections are most effective when paired with silicone sheets or pressure earrings for ear keloids. Many emphasize that a 6-to-12 month commitment is necessary to maintain results and prevent the scar from regrowing.
Keloids frequently return because they result from an overactive healing response to skin trauma. Recurrence rates vary between 45% and 100% for surgery alone. Using combination therapies and specialized protocols significantly improves long-term outcomes for patients in the United Arab Emirates.

Mature scars that have stopped growing for years have only a 4.5% recurrence rate after surgery.
Patient Consensus: Patients note that consistency with pressure garments and silicone sheets is the hardest but most important step. Many find that earlobe keloids return faster than anticipated without strict following of aftercare routines.
Keloid treatment in the United Arab Emirates typically requires 4 to 12 sessions for visible results. Most protocols involve injections or laser therapy spaced 4 to 6 weeks apart. Visible reduction in keloid size typically occurs between 3 and 6 months of consistent treatment. Patients in the United Arab Emirates often notice initial relief from itching or discomfort within 2 weeks. Full flattening and color blending usually require 1 to 2 years of therapy.

Successful keloid treatment in the United Arab Emirates requires strict UV protection and tension management. Patients must avoid blood thinners for 10 days before procedures. Post-treatment care focusing on silicone therapy and steroid schedules significantly reduces the high natural recurrence rates of these scars.

For complex keloids, combining surgical excision with immediate radiation therapy is a proven strategy. This specific protocol reduces recurrence rates to under 10% compared to 50% for surgery alone.
Patient Consensus: Patients emphasize that using silicone sheets 24/7 for the first half-year is vital. Many also suggest starting triamcinolone injections early to keep the scar flat and soft during healing.
Keloid surgery in the United Arab Emirates is effective when paired with immediate follow-up therapies. Standalone excision has a recurrence rate of 50% to 100%. However, UAE specialists use multi-modal protocols. These combinations reduce the risk of recurrence to under 20%.

The most common non-surgical keloid treatment in the United Arab Emirates is intralesional corticosteroid injection therapy. Dermatologists in Dubai and Abu Dhabi also use laser therapy, cryotherapy, and regenerative medicine. These procedures flatten scar tissue and reduce itching without surgical incisions.

Dermatologists in the United Arab Emirates advise against new tattoos or piercings if you have keloids. Treatment flattens existing scars but does not change your genetic healing response. Any new skin trauma can trigger aggressive scar growth. Most specialists recommend waiting 12 to 18 months after treatment ends.

International health insurance covers keloid scar treatment in the United Arab Emirates if surgeons deem it medically necessary. Insurers approve claims for physical symptoms like pain, restricted movement, or chronic itching. Cosmetic treatments for visual appearance alone stay elective and require self-funding.
